America authorities has reacted to the report submitted to the Lagos State authorities by the Lagos State Judicial Panel of Inquiry on Restitution for Victims of SARS Associated Abuses and different issues.

Naija Information experiences that the Justice Doris Okuwobi (retired)-led panel had on Monday submitted it’s report back to the Lagos State Governor, Babajide Sanwo-Olu.

Whereas Nigeria’s Minister of Info and Tradition, Lai Mohammed, had on a number of events after the Lekki Toll Gate shootings of October 20, 2020, insisted that no life was misplaced, and even demanded apologies from individuals and organizations with experiences on lack of lives through the incident, the report of the panel disclosed that not lower than eleven individuals have been killed on the Lekki tollgate incident.

The report added that no less than 48 protesters have been both shot useless, injured with bullet wounds, or assaulted by troopers.

Reacting in an announcement on Tuesday, the US Mission in Nigeria mentioned it’s awaiting the response of the Muhammadu Buhari-led administration and that of the Lagos authorities.

The US Embassy mentioned the response of authorities would characterize an necessary mechanism of accountability concerning the EndSARS protests and the occasions on the tollgate.

“These occasions led to severe allegations towards some members of the safety forces.

“We stay up for the Lagos State and federal governments taking appropriate measures to deal with these alleged abuses in addition to the grievances of the victims and their households,” the assertion reads.
